City's 496th Anniversary, Three Parks in Central Jakarta Being Beautified

Three parks located in Central Jakarta are seen being beautified in order to welcome Jakarta 496th anniversary.

We decorate the park with colorful plants to make it more festive

Central Jakarta Parks and City Forest Sub-agency Head, Mila Ananda said the three parks that will be beautified are located in the yard of the mayor's office, Bank Indonesia area, and Arjuna Wijaya Statue or Patung Kuda (Horse Statue).

"We decorate the park with colorful plants to make it more festive," she expressed Wednesday (6/21).

Her party prepared 7,953 polybags of ornamental plants in this park decoration, with details of 2,500 polybags of yellow and orange marigots, 500 polybags of purple celosia, and 2,000 polybags of red celosia.

"There are also 200 polybags of palm cabbage and 153 polybags of kadaka," she explained.

His party also added river stone and natural stone ornaments under the plants along with ornaments that read Jakarta's Anniversary.

"We started decorating the park two days ago by deploying 20 personnel," she added.

He hoped that this beautification of these three parks could add a festive impression to Jakarta's anniversary celebrations.

"Hopefully, Jakarta can be more lively," he hoped.
